Floppy Kid Syndrome is a distinctive metabolic disorder affecting young goat kids, characterized by sudden onset of profound muscular weakness that causes affected animals to become limp and unable to stand or hold their heads up normally. The condition typically strikes apparently healthy, well-fed kids between three and ten days of age, transforming vigorous young animals into seemingly lifeless forms within a matter of hours. Despite its dramatic presentation, Floppy Kid Syndrome has an excellent prognosis when recognized promptly and treated appropriately, making awareness and rapid response essential for successful outcomes.
The syndrome primarily affects kids from dairy goat breeds and is strongly associated with high milk intake and rapid early growth, earning it a reputation for striking the best kids in a group. Kids being raised on their dams with abundant milk supply or those receiving generous amounts of milk replacer face the highest risk. The condition appears to result from a form of metabolic acidosis, where the blood becomes excessively acidic due to factors related to the immature digestive system's response to high milk consumption, though the exact pathophysiological mechanism remains incompletely understood.
